Lisa Francine Richardson, 52, of Brownwood passed away Monday, Feb. 23.
Lisa was born July 13, 1962 in Brownwood, to the parentage of Raymond and Francis Richardson. Lisa received her primary education from the Brownwood Independent School District. Lisa was a loveable person who loved everyone. She loved to spend time with her family, especially her grandchildren who she loved dearly. Some of her hobbies included crafting, making reefs for the holidays, painting, drinking diet coke, and watching her grandchildren fish.
Lisa was preceded in death by both parents; three sisters, Mona Williams, Judith Long, Sherry Mobley; and one brother, Johnny Richardson.
Left to cherish her memories are daughter, Shay Richardson of Brownwood; son, David Richardson of Lubbock; and their father David Stenson of Melbourne Fla.; grandchildren, Treyvon Mitchell, Jacoby Richardson, McKinney Richardson and Catrina Brooks; five brothers, Wesley Richardson (Marcy) of Austin, Joe Bob Richardson of Brownwood, Dennis Richardson of Saginaw, Jimmy Cotton of Emory and Bryan Richardson of Lampasas; and numerous nieces, nephews, extended family and friends.
